Long time passing--- since I saw any dealers with LE Colt carbines.  Sorry if this has been discussed; please refer me.

Saw prices this week at a show, one guy had three 6520s and wanted 1800 for them.  I passed.

Is there an embargo?  Did Colt change policies?  Thanks.

It has been mentioned, but a thread about it is a good idea. I d like to know too

Conventional wisdom is that Colt production lines are wide open producing M4's for govt sales and periodically they switch over for LE runs - which someone said was "spring-time" making them on dealer shelves mid/late summer

Compound that with what is sure to be a brisk demands for the 10 series guns, and the Colt could be scarce for most for some time to come

I read from a Colt release that they made only 4,100 LE6920's in 2004 and only 1,600 or so LE6721's (same year)

With numbers like those, it is no wonder they command a bit more

But I'd not be surprised if 2005 were 2 or 3 times those numbers

The two distributors that I talked to told me that colt is not doing any shipping until the end of summer.  And both of these distributors are LE at that.  I have heard 3 reasons as to why, but I'm not sure which one or combination of them are true.

1.  Filling large Military contract orders.
2.  Something to do with a buyout.  General dynamics??
3.  Colt is gearing up a new LE line of piston operated AR's.

I just know that I had my 6920 on order at the beginning of last moonth, and it was supposed to be in now.  But the distributor called me and said Clt told them what I said above.  Not shipping any orders/suppliers until end of summer.  I'm not waiting that long, so I just ordered an RRA entry Tac.  We'll see how that fairs...
